The recipe is incredibly simple. Slice one organic cucumber and one lemon into thin rounds. Place them in a large pitcher of filtered water and let the mixture infuse overnight in the refrigerator. For an extra boost, you can add a few sprigs of fresh mint or a small piece of ginger root, both of which enhance flavor and add even more health benefits
